El Paso, Texas (KTSM) — Tropical Storm Beryl is currently in the Gulf of Mexico on Saturday afternoon with sustained winds of 60 mph.

Beryl is expected to re-strengthen into a hurricane by Sunday before making its landfall on the Texas coast. Landfall is forecasted to take place Sunday night or Monday morning.

The National Weather Service has issued a Heat Advisory and it is expected to expire at 6 a.m. on Monday, July 8.

On Sunday,  we are forecasting sunny skies and dry conditions. Our predicted high for this day is expected to reach a scorching 106 degrees with an overnight low cooling off to 78 degrees.

Stay hydrated, take frequent breaks if you are outdoors for long periods of time and wear light clothing to help keep you cool.

Now, we begin to see a moisture pattern starting Monday through Thursday.

Monday, we are forecasting a 40% chance of storms mainly in the evening. During the day, we can expect to reach a high of 100 degrees with evening temperatures sitting at 74 degrees.

Double digits are predicted for Tuesday, with a forecasted high of 99 degrees. We will also have a 30% chance of afternoon thunderstorms which may create a humid atmosphere for us this day.

Wednesday, we have a slight chance of storms once again with a high expected to remain in the double digits at 98 degrees. Wednesday evening, we are forecasting to sit at 76 degrees.

As we continue the pattern of moisture into Thursday, humidity will remain a factor in our weather conditions. We are predicting a 20% chance of afternoon storms that can possibly bleed into the evening.

Storm chances will continue for both Friday and Saturday. Friday’s high is expected to warm up to 100 degrees, while Saturday sits at 99 degrees.

Sunday, we are in for another double-digit day at 98 degrees, with some cloud coverage throughout the day with an evening temperatures at 77 degrees.

Monday will kick back up to those triple digits and partly cloudy skies.
